前卫目录网

TreeView 控件:用于在桌面应用程序和 Web 应用程序中组织和显示分层数据的强大工具 (treeview翻译)


文章编号:1026 / 更新时间:2024-12-30 07:26:56 / 浏览:
用于在桌面应用和

TreeView控件是一种强大且通用的工具,用于在桌面应用程序和Web应用程序中组织和显示分层数据。它允许用户以树状结构可视化和交互式地浏览数据,从而可以轻松地查看和操作数据。TreeView控件可以用于各种应用程序,从文件浏览器到组织结构图。

TreeView控件的功能

  • 分层数据可视化: TreeView控件可以将数据组织成树状结构,其中父节点包含子节点,子节点又可以包含自己的子节点,以此类推。这种组织方式使用户能够轻松地查看和浏览数据层次结构。
  • 节点展开和折叠: 用户可以通过展开和折叠节点来控制TreeView控件中显示的数据量。这允许他们专注于特定的数据部分,同时隐藏不相关的详细信息。
  • 节点选中和取消选中: TreeView控件允许用户选择和取消选择树中的节点。这可以用于各种操作,例如导航、编辑或删除数据。
  • 拖放: 许多TreeView控件支持拖放功能,允许用户轻松地重新组织和移动数据。这可以用于创建新的节点、移动现有节点或复制数据到其他位置。

TreeView控件的类型

有不同类型的TreeView控件,每种控件都有自己的功能和特性。最常見的類型包括:
  • 层次结构TreeView:这种类型的TreeView控件显示具有明确层次结构的数据。每个节点都有一个父节点,除了根节点之外,除非展开,否则不会显示子节点。
  • 平面TreeView:这种类型的TreeView控件显示没有明确层>混合TreeView:这种类型的TreeView控件结合了分层结构和平面TreeView的特性。它允许用户在树的不同部分创建和管理层次结构。

TreeView控件的使用

TreeView控件可以通过多种编程语言框架轻松集成到应用程序中。在大多数情况下,可以使用以下步骤使用TreeView控件:
  1. 创建TreeView控件:您需要在应用程序中创建TreeView控件实例。这可以通过使用适当的控件类或通过在标记语言中定义控件来实现。
  2. 加载数据:接下来,您需要加载要显示在TreeView控件中的数据。这可以通过程序方式加载数据或从外部数据源(如数据库或XML文件)加载数据来完成。
  3. 配置控件:您可以配置TreeView控件以自定义其外观和行为。这包括设置节点样式、启用拖放,以及设置事件处理程序以响应用户交互。
  4. 处理事件: TreeView控件引发各种事件,例如节点展开、折叠、选中和取消选中。您可以处理这些事件来执行特定的操作,例如导航到新页面或编辑数据。

TreeView控件的优点

使用TreeView控件有许多优点,包括:
  • 数据组织: TreeView控件提供了一种有效组织和显示分层数据的机制。这有助于用户查找和访问特定信息。
  • 易于导航:展开和折叠节点允许用户轻松浏览数据层次结构。这可以节省时间和精力。
  • 数据可视化: TreeView控件为用户提供数据的可视化表示,使他们能够一目了然地理解数据结构
  • 交互性: TreeView控件允许用户通过展开、折叠、选中和取消选择节点与数据交互。这提供了对数据的动态控制。
  • 扩展性: TreeView控件通常是可扩展的,允许开发人员添加自定义功能和行为以满足特定应用程序的需求。性: TreeView控件可能很复杂,尤其是在处理大量数据或多重层次结构时。
  • 性能:在某些情况下,TreeView控件可能会对性能产生负面影响,尤其是在处理大量数据或复杂层次结构时。
  • 可访问性: TreeView控件可能对屏幕阅读器和辅助技术难以访问。
  • 维护:维护TreeView控件可能需要大量工作,尤其是在数据经常更改或需要重新组织时。

结论

TreeView控件是用于在桌面应用程序和Web应用程序中组织和显示分层数据的强大工具。它们提供各种功能和优点,包括数据组织、易于导航、数据可视化、交互性和可扩展性。它们也有一些缺点,包括复杂性、性能、可访问性和维护。TreeView控件在需要以分层方式组织和呈现数据时提供了一个有价值的解决方案。
相关标签: 用于在桌面应用程序和treeview翻译Web控件TreeView应用程序中组织和显示分层数据的强大工具

本文地址:https://www.qianwe.com/article/b4532e4a94534c27b577.html

上一篇:编程软件排行榜B编程软件...
下一篇:百度音乐控件下载聆听海量音乐,享受极致体验...

发表评论

温馨提示

做上本站友情链接,在您站上点击一次,即可自动收录并自动排在本站第一位!
<a href="https://www.qianwe.com/" target="_blank">前卫目录网</a>